Impetus Technologies

Chester SY14 8HP ,United Kingdom
Impetus Technologies Impetus Technologies is one of the popular Business Service located in , listed under Local business in Chester , Business service in Chester ,

Contact Details & Working Hours

Map of Impetus Technologies